ошибка при установке мезаструктуры в команде 'делает linux-x86'

nir@nir:~/Downloads/mesa-8.0$ make linux-x86
make default
make[1]: Entering directory `/home/nir/Downloads/mesa-8.0'
make[2]: Entering directory `/home/nir/Downloads/mesa-8.0/src'
Making sources for linux-x86
make[3]: Entering directory `/home/nir/Downloads/mesa-8.0/src/glsl'
flex --nounistd -oglcpp/glcpp-lex.c  glcpp/glcpp-lex.l
make[3]: flex: Command not found
make[3]: *** התיינבל םיללכ ןיא ךא ,`depend' תשרוד `default' הרטמ.  Stop. **//trnaslaet from hebrew: target 'default' Requires `depend' But there are no rules for building. Stop.**
make[3]: Leaving directory `/home/nir/Downloads/mesa-8.0/src/glsl'
make[2]: *** [subdirs] 1 הלקת **//trnaslaet from hebrew: fault**
make[2]: Leaving directory `/home/nir/Downloads/mesa-8.0/src'
make[1]: *** [default] 1 הלקת **//trnaslaet from hebrew: fault**
make[1]: Leaving directory `/home/nir/Downloads/mesa-8.0'
make: *** [linux-x86] 2 הלקת **//trnaslaet from hebrew: fault**
nir@nir:~/Downloads/mesa-8.0$ 

Есть ли какое-либо решение?Спасибо!

0
задан 12 February 2012 в 22:40

1 ответ

Ошибка довольно очевидна:

make[3]: flex: Command not found

Mesa имеет зависимость от сборки flex, которую можно установить с помощью:

sudo apt-get install flex

Чтобы установить все зависимости сборки для Mesa запустите:

sudo apt-get build-dep mesa
0
ответ дан 12 February 2012 в 22:40

Другие вопросы по тегам:

Похожие вопросы: